Do You Need Experience for a Jet Ski Dolphin Tour?
You do not need years of watercraft experience to join the tour. Many guests arrive as a beginner jet ski rider and learn the basic controls during the pre-tour safety orientation.
Before entering the water, your guide will explain how to start, stop, turn, and control your speed. You will also learn how to maintain a safe following distance and respond to the guide’s hand signals.
The controls are usually simple to understand. However, listening carefully during the orientation is important because a personal watercraft responds differently from a car or bicycle.
A guide may ask you to practice at a lower speed before the group begins traveling. This short practice period helps you become familiar with the throttle, steering, and balance.
Your comfort often improves quickly once you begin riding a jet ski in open water. Still, you should follow the guide’s pace instead of trying to test the watercraft’s maximum speed.
Passengers also need to understand basic positioning. They should remain centered, hold on securely, and lean gently with the driver during turns.
What The Safety Briefing May Cover
Before departure, guests can expect instructions about:
- Starting and shutting off the watercraft
- Using the emergency safety lanyard
- Steering and slowing down
- Keeping space between riders
- Crossing wakes safely
- Following the tour guide
- Responding if someone falls into the water
- Approaching wildlife responsibly
The guide may adjust the route or speed based on weather, water traffic, and group ability. Therefore, every dolphin cruise can feel slightly different.
Age and licensing rules may also apply. Guests should review current operator requirements when making a reservation and bring any requested identification or documentation.
Preparing for Your First Tour
Arriving early gives you time to complete paperwork, receive equipment, and listen to instructions without feeling rushed. It also allows the staff to address any questions before the group leaves.
Wear clothing that can get wet. A swimsuit, rash guard, quick-dry shirt, or lightweight water clothing usually works better than heavy cotton garments.
For a first jet ski rental, choose secure clothing that will stay comfortable while seated. Loose accessories can blow away, while bulky clothing may become heavy after getting wet.
Footwear requirements can vary. Water shoes with secure straps may offer grip and foot protection, while flip-flops can slip off easily.
Apply water-resistant sunscreen before arriving when possible. You may also want to bring extra sunscreen for use after the tour, especially during longer outings.
Guests often ask what to bring on a jet ski before their reservation. In most cases, it helps to keep your personal items limited because storage space on the watercraft may be small.
Useful Items To Prepare
Consider bringing:
- A valid photo ID
- Required boating documentation
- Water-resistant sunscreen
- A secure pair of sunglasses
- A sunglasses strap
- A towel for after the tour
- Dry clothes to leave in your vehicle
- Drinking water for before and after the ride
- A waterproof case for approved personal items
Avoid bringing valuables that you do not need. Jewelry, loose hats, wallets, and unprotected phones can become lost or damaged on the water.
Ask the jet ski rental team about phone and camera policies before departure. Some operators allow securely mounted devices, while others may limit them for safety reasons.

What Equipment is Usually Provided

Your jet ski dolphin tour provider should supply an approved life jacket. Staff members will help select the correct size and check that it fits securely.
A safety lanyard may connect the rider to the watercraft’s emergency shutoff system. This device can stop the engine if the operator becomes separated from the controls.
Some tours may provide additional safety or communication equipment. The exact gear can depend on the route, local regulations, and current water conditions.
Listen closely when the guide explains how to use each item. Safety equipment offers the most protection when guests wear and use it correctly.
What Happens During the Tour?
Once everyone feels ready, the guide will lead the group away from the launch area. Riders normally travel in an organized line while maintaining a safe distance from one another.
The first part of the trip may move at a controlled pace. This gives new riders time to become comfortable before entering wider waterways.
As the tour continues, you may pass marshes, inlets, channels, or coastal scenery. The exact route can change because guides consider tides, boat traffic, wind, and wildlife activity.
When dolphins appear, the guide may slow the group or direct riders to a viewing area. Guests should remain patient and follow all instructions during watching dolphins from the water.
Dolphins are wild animals, so sightings cannot always be guaranteed. Their location and activity can change based on feeding patterns, water temperature, weather, and other natural conditions.
Responsible tours do not chase, feed, surround, or touch marine wildlife. Instead, riders observe from a respectful distance and allow the animals to choose their own direction.
A personal watercraft offers a different experience from a traditional dolphin cruise. You sit closer to the water and actively participate in the journey rather than remaining on a larger passenger boat.
However, guests should not focus only on dolphin sightings. The ride itself can provide memorable views, fresh air, and a guided introduction to the local waterways.
How to stay comfortable during the ride
Keep both hands on the handlebars unless the guide says it is safe to stop. Maintain a relaxed grip because squeezing too tightly can cause hand and arm fatigue.
Look ahead instead of directly down at the watercraft. This position can improve balance and help you notice waves, boats, and changes in the guide’s direction.
Slow down before making sharper turns. A controlled approach makes the ride smoother for both the driver and passenger.
When crossing a wake, follow the method taught during the safety briefing. Do not attempt jumps or sudden maneuvers that go against tour rules.
Speak up if you feel tired, uncomfortable, or unsure. The guide can often adjust the pace, offer additional instructions, or help you return safely.
What happens after the tour
At the end of the route, the guide will lead everyone back to the launch area. Continue following the group formation until the watercraft is fully stopped and staff members provide docking instructions.
You may feel wet, energized, and ready to discuss the highlights of the trip. Having a towel and dry clothing nearby can make the transition back to shore more comfortable.
Before leaving, check that you have collected your identification and personal belongings. You can also ask the staff about photos, future reservations, or other water activities.
